    Lower unit oil - again, Seahorse or Rusty

    A number of post ago, a member ask for the best OMC lower unit gear oil. The reply was HPF-XR. Question is what is the difference in using HPF-PRO ?

    HPF XR lube is the factory fill gearcase lube for Evinrude E-TEC, DI and Johnson 2-stroke outboards. It is reccomended for extra heavy duty service needs including high-performance outboards, commercial fleets, rental operations etc.

    HPF PRO lube is for severe duty applications.
